In "The Bridge," Gwen Comeaux grapples with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S),
a condition that threatens her dream of motherhood. Desperate for a child, Gwen
seeks unconventional help from the enigmatic witch doctor Dumache. However,
her decision proves to be a grave mistake, unleashing sinister forces that haunt
her family for generations.
Mark Turner (Male, 30s mid 40's, Caucasian)
Description: Mark is a dedicated yet overworked businessman, often seen in business attire and frequently on his phone. He struggles to balance his demanding job with his family life, which leads to tension with his wife, Rachel, and occasional neglect of his daughter, Lilly. Mark is well-meaning but often appears distant and preoccupied, prioritizing work over family. Requirements: Strong presence and the ability to portray a character torn between professional obligations and family duties. Experience in playing roles that require a mix of authority and vulnerability is preferred.
Patricia
Age: Late twenties
Ethnicity: Unspecified
Description: Patricia is an attractive woman in her late twenties, exuding professionalism and poise in every gesture. As Mark's secretary, she demonstrates efficiency and competence while maintaining a friendly and approachable demeanor. With her poised presence, she enters Mark's office with a sense of purpose, holding a box and ready to assist. Patricia's dedication to her work is evident as she patiently waits for Mark's attention, displaying professionalism and reliability. Despite her professional demeanor, she shares a warm rapport with Mark, expressing genuine camaraderie and admiration for him. Seeking an actress who can portray Patricia's blend of professionalism, warmth, and efficiency with authenticity and grace.
